summ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--meson/suppressions/meson.build7
1 files changed, 6 insertions, 1 deletions
diff --git a/meson/suppressions/meson.build b/meson/suppressions/meson.build
index d0593f2..722b754 100644
--- a/meson/suppressions/meson.build
+++ b/meson/suppressions/meson.build
@@ -79,7 +79,6 @@ if is_variable('cc')
elif cc.get_id() == 'msvc'
c_suppressions += [
'/wd4061', # enumerator in switch is not explicitly handled
- '/wd4090', # different const qualifiers
'/wd4191', # unsafe conversion from FARPROC
'/wd4244', # conversion from floating point, possible loss of data
'/wd4267', # conversion from size_t, possible loss of data
@@ -96,6 +95,12 @@ if is_variable('cc')
]
endif
+ else
+ if cc.get_id() == 'msvc'
+ c_suppressions += [
+ '/wd4090', # different const qualifiers
+ ]
+ endif
endif
c_suppressions = cc.get_supported_arguments(c_suppressions)